Riyadh Rocked by Explosions Amid Escalating Houthi Attacks

Saudi Arabia's civil defense agency issued an all-clear for Riyadh after explosions were heard in the city, prompting air raid alerts and a warning of potential danger. The move comes amid an uptick in attacks by Iran-aligned Houthis on the Gulf country.

According to Reuters and AFP journalists, two explosions were heard in Riyadh on Saturday, following an alert issued by Saudi authorities. This is the first time Riyadh has been affected by the conflict in neighboring Yemen, which intensified in July.

The Houthis' military spokesperson claimed that the rebel group had foiled 'criminal attempts' allegedly backed by Saudi Arabia in capital Sanaa, vowing a response.
